So what are the factors causing wax deposition in gear oil pump pipelines?
1. Pipeline pressure
When the pipeline pressure is lower than the saturation pressure of crude oil, gas-phase substances in the crude oil will dissociate from it, which not only reduces the content of light components in the crude oil, but also takes away some of the heat in the crude oil, resulting in an increase in wax deposition after the dual factors.
2. Composition and properties of crude oil in pipelines
The heavy components contained in crude oil have a direct impact on the wax deposition effect. The more heavy components there are, the less soluble the wax in the crude oil is, and the more severe the tendency for wax deposition. But the gum and asphaltene contained in crude oil have an impact on wax deposition in pipelines. Colloidal substances refer to compounds with high molecular weight in crude oil, belonging to a type of surface active substance. They are dispersed in a semi-solid state in crude oil and can adsorb on the surface of wax at the beginning of crystallization, playing a role in isolation and preventing wax crystals from continuing to grow. Asphalt is a type of polymer that is dispersed in small particles in crude oil and can act as a dispersant for wax crystals. As the content of resin increases, the temperature of wax precipitation decreases, and the wax crystals are evenly dispersed and tightly bound to the resin. However, in the presence of gum and asphaltene, wax deposits on the pipe wall and is not easily washed away by the oil flow. In summary, to a certain extent, the presence of gum and asphaltene can both alleviate wax deposition and increase the bonding strength of wax, thereby reducing wax deposition.
3. Mechanical impurities and water components in crude oil
The mechanical impurities and rough surface in crude oil are conducive to the adhesion and crystallization of wax molecules. The more mechanical impurities contained in crude oil, the easier it is for wax deposition to occur during pipeline transportation.
4. Pipe wall roughness and surface material
The wax deposition in the gear oil pump pipeline is affected by the pipeline material: the rougher the inner wall of the pipeline, the easier it is for the crude oil to hang on the inner wall of the pipeline during transportation, making it more prone to wax deposition. On the contrary, the smoother the pipe wall, the smoother the flow of crude oil, and the less likely it is to wax deposition. In addition, for the material of the inner wall of the pipeline, lipophilic materials are more prone to wax formation than hydrophilic materials.
5. The running time of the pipeline
As the running time of the pipeline increases, the conveying distance increases, and the thickness of the wax layer becomes thicker. When a certain time is reached, the degree of thickening gradually decreases. This is because the thickness of the wax layer increases, leading to an increase in thermal resistance, a decrease in the heat transfer coefficient between the oil temperature and the pipe wall, a decrease in temperature difference, and a gradual decrease in wax deposition increment.
6. Flow velocity of fluid in pipeline
The faster the oil flow velocity in the gear oil pump pipeline, the greater the shear stress on the pipe wall, and the stronger the flushing effect of the oil flow on the pipe wall. The lower the wax deposition rate, the less likely the wax in the crude oil is to deposit, and the thickness of wax deposition on the pipe wall becomes thinner.
7. The ambient temperature of the fluid inside the pipeline
Wax deposition is greatly affected by temperature. When the temperature is low, the fluidity of high wax crude oil decreases, the movement of wax molecules slows down, and it is easy to crystallize and precipitate. Therefore, when the temperature of crude oil is low, it is prone to wax formation. In addition, due to the temperature difference between the crude oil temperature and the pipe wall temperature, wax will crystallize on the surface of the pipe wall, which is also the main factor leading to wax deposition in pipelines.
